Bus interconnection in multiprocessor environment: The communication principle and the arbitration techniques
Abstract
The structure and the algorithms of the arbiter function managing the data traffic in a multibus architecture are studied. The arbitration algorithms such as daisy chaining, polling or independent request are reviewed. An arbitration algorithm is implemented to be used in the ARCADE multibus multiprocessor system. The bus system of ARCADE is described and an experimental model is implemented. The resulting system is more complex than originally estimated, leading to another approach which is outlined: a high rate multipurpose interconnection structure.
